As companies continue their efforts to improve work performance, they must ensure that their ongoing Lean activities include a healthy appreciation for, and recognition of, human performance. Ignoring the human component of work performance can be a recipe for unnecessary waste, inefficiency, and decreased productivity. Lean Human Performance Improvement presents a broad overview of human performance in the workplace. The author discusses his findings from a broad spectrum of human performance-related fields and diverse industrial sectors (gained by working in the field for over 30 years).
Organized in three sections, this book covers understanding human performance, analyzing and improving work productivity, and analyzing and improving quality and safety. The author first develops a fundamental and basic understanding of human performance, then couples that understanding with learning how to analyze and improve human-related work productivity and quality and safety. He also discusses how knowledge and skills transfer from one work setting to another.
Intended for Lean Six Sigma team members and human performance improvement practitioners, the book contains multiple examples from diverse work settings to explain key points. It also includes several major case studies. The goal of all examples and case studies is to develop a generic understanding that, in turn, can be successfully applied to any work setting.

Описание: Features statistical and operational research methods and tools being used to improve the healthcare industry With a focus on cutting–edge approaches to the quickly growing field of healthcare, Healthcare Analytics: From Data to Knowledge to Healthcare Improvement provides an integrated and comprehensive treatment on recent research advancements in data–driven healthcare analytics in an effort to provide more personalized and efficient healthcare services. Emphasizing data and healthcare analytics from an operational management and statistical perspective, the book details how analytical methods and tools can be utilized to enhance care quality and operational efficiency. Organized into two main sections, Part One features biomedical and health informatics and specifically addresses the analytics of genomic and proteomic data; physiological signals from patient monitoring systems; data uncertainty in clinical laboratory tests; predictive modeling; disease modeling for sepsis; and the design of cyber infrastructures for early prediction of epidemic events. Part Two focuses on healthcare delivery systems, including system advances for transforming clinic workflow and patient care; macro analysis of patient flow distribution; intensive care units; primary care; demand and resource allocation; mathematical models for predicting patient readmission and postoperative outcome; physician–patient interactions; insurance claims; and the role of social media in healthcare. Hui Yang, PhD, is Associate Professor in the Harold and Inge Marcus Department of Industrial and Manufacturing Engineering at The Pennsylvania State University. His research interests include sensor–based modeling and analysis of complex systems for process monitoring/control; system diagnostics/prognostics; quality improvement; and performance optimization with special focus on nonlinear stochastic dynamics and the resulting chaotic, recurrence, self–organizing behaviors. Eva K. Lee, PhD, is Professor in the H. Milton Stewart School of Industrial and Systems Engineering at the Georgia Institute of Technology, Director of the Center for Operations Research in Medicine and HealthCare, and Distinguished Scholar in Health System, Health Systems Institute at both Emory University School of Medicine and Georgia Institute of Technology. Her research interests include health risk prediction; early disease prediction and diagnosis; optimal treatment strategies and drug delivery; healthcare outcome analysis and treatment prediction; public health and medical preparedness; large–scale healthcare/medical decision analysis and quality improvement; clinical translational science; and business intelligence and organization transformation.
